Infront Consolidated Market Data

In recent years, trading has become more fragmented than ever – due, in large part, to new Markets in Financial Instruments Directive (MiFID) legislation in the European Union.  Infront helps professional investors to overcome this fragmentation by collecting market data from across multiple trading venues and presenting it in a single consolidated view.

NASDAQ TotalView Explained

NASDAQ TotalView – which displays the full order depth for NASDAQ market participants – is recognized as the standard NASDAQ feed for serious traders. NYSE Realtime Fees for Professional Users

Fees for professional users of NYSE realtime data are based on a 14-tier schedule, and a special agreement with NYSE is required to access the data.  This article explains the tiers, and the process for confirming the necessary agreements.
